Ellie Chalupsky, a four-time South Carolina High School Champion from Bishop England High School across both the 3A and 4A divisions, is headed to Arizona State, joining the Sun Devils’ class of 2030.
I’m extremely blessed and excited to announce my verbal commitment to continue my academic and athletic career at Arizona State University. I want to thank my parents, family, coaches, friends, and most importantly God for the guidance and support along the way. Thank you Coach Herbie and the ASU coaches for giving me this amazing opportunity. I am so grateful to be part of this team & for my future as a Lady Devil! Go Sun Devils! Forks Up!
The Charleston, SC, brought home her first South Carolina High School state titles as a Sophomore, competing in the 3A division in October of 2023. She stopped the clock in 57.04 in the 100 butterfly and 58.26 in the 100 backstroke, earning her first of four career individual state championships.
The following year, as a junior, Chalupsky doubled down on those two races, this time in the 4A division. She clocked 55.35 in the 100 fly (a 1.69-second drop from the year before), and 55.77 in the 100 back (2.49 seconds better than her 2023 performance). Earning her 3rd and 4th individual titles.
She has raced the 100 back all three years at the South Carolina State Championships, having placed 2nd as a freshman in 3A (59.01). All three years she has spent at Bishop England have resulted in team state titles.
None of those races, however, mark her top performances in her career; some of her best swims came at the SwimAtlanta Best of the South meet this past March, where she set lifetime standards in the 200 back (1:58.47), 200 freestyle (1:49.87), 50 free (23.12), and 100 fly (55.75). She also lowered her 100 back best earlier this year at the South Carolina Senior Short-Course Championships, touching in 54.68.

The Arizona State women took home the Big 12 title last season at the 2025 Big 12 Swimming and Diving Championships in their first season in the conference, though on the national level, they still lag behind their male counterparts. Still, they made progress in that regard in 2025, finishing 19th at last season’s NCAA Swimming and Diving Championships (five spots better than their 24th-place finish in 2024).
Chalupsky’s best times would have qualified 8th in the 100 back, 15th in the 200 back, and 25th (1st alternate) in the 200 free.
Caroline Bentz was a headliner for the Sun Devil women a year ago, winning the 100 and 200 backstrokes at Big 12s in her senior campaign in Tempe. While not yet on the level of Bentz, Chalupsky is a prospect with a steep progression over the last two years alone. She could find herself filling in the Bentz-type role in the coming years, especially with her range of possible events and with the departure of Bentz from Arizona State.
